Kamarni Ryan, Klevis Muca and Eoin Bolger move to Whitehawk

 

Whitehawk announced a number of signings prior to our big kick off, and that included the trio of Kamarni Ryan, Klevis Muca and Eoin Bolger.

 

Midfielder Kamarni Ryan comes in from Burnley, where he played for the Under 21 side. He moved to Turf Moor in the summer of 2024 on a two year deal, after departing Arsenal, where he played for the Under 18 side, and that isn't the end of his experience, as prior to the Gunners he spent time with both Chelsea and Norwich City (although it seems to have been a very short time with the latter, one match for the Under 18's!). Unless there are two players with the same name, which we doubt, he played five matches for Redbridge in the closing stages of last season, scoring once. 

 

Goalkeeper Klevis Muca has just signed his first professional contract with Sutton United and becomes a loan Hawk. The player first came to our attention with Corinthian-Casuals, and then spent time at Carshalton Athletic and Chipstead. He made fourteen appearances for the Chips on loan during 24-25, and last season had a fabulous campaign for the Under 18's at Gander Green Lane, keeping sixteen clean sheets and playing sixty seven times!

 

Eoin Bolger arrives from Walton and Hersham, the full back playing thirty six times last season as the Swans earned promotion to National League South by charging to the Pitching In Southern Premier South title. He joined the Swans aged seventeen, played initially for the youth side before breaking through to the first team, and played his one hundredth first team match back in January. He has also played- on dual registration- for Cobham.
